The monetary control framework of Guyana : experiences, lessons and consequences

Summary: Examines the monetary policy framework of Guyana. Proposes several factors that might account for the persistently high levels of excess liquidity. Argues that it is not automatic that the excess liquidity is driving the rate of inflation. Investigates the factors which account for variations in excess reserves.
